1. Marvel at Piazza del Duomo's Grandeur
Begin your exploration of Pistoia with a visit to the magnificent Piazza del Duomo, the city's central square. This vibrant hub showcases a stunning array of medieval architecture, including the Duomo (Cathedral of San Zeno), the Baptistery of San Giovanni in Corte, and the Palazzo del Comune. Take your time to admire the intricate details of each building. Consider a guided tour of the Duomo to delve into its rich history and artistic treasures. 4. Wander Through the Historic Ospedale del Ceppo
Step back in time as you wander through the historic Ospedale del Ceppo, an architectural marvel and former hospital, showcasing Pistoia's rich past. Dating back to the 13th century, this site features a remarkable frieze of glazed terracotta depicting the Seven Works of Mercy. These vibrant, detailed panels are a must-see, illustrating scenes from daily life centuries ago. 5. Explore the Underground Pistoia Sotterranea
Uncover a hidden world beneath Pistoia with a fascinating tour of Pistoia Sotterranea. This unique experience takes you deep under the city's surface, revealing ancient passages and underground structures. During this tour you can learn about the history and engineering behind this subterranean network, originally built to manage water resources. Therefore it offers a different perspective on Pistoia's past. Knowledgeable guides lead the way, sharing intriguing stories and insights into this hidden realm. 7. Visit the Church of Sant'Andrea's Pulpit
Visiting the Church of Sant'Andrea is a must for any art lover exploring Pistoia. The church is famed for its exquisite marble pulpit sculpted by Giovanni Pisano, a masterpiece of Gothic art. This elaborate pulpit narrates the life of Christ with intricate carvings and dramatic scenes. Moreover, the detailed craftsmanship and expressive figures offer a captivating glimpse into medieval artistry. 8. Experience Contemporary Art at Palazzo Fabroni
Immerse yourself in the modern art scene at Palazzo Fabroni, a key stop for contemporary art enthusiasts exploring Pistoia. Housed in a beautifully restored 18th-century building, the museum showcases an impressive collection of Italian and international contemporary art. Allow at least 2-3 hours to fully appreciate the thought-provoking exhibits and installations. Furthermore, the palazzo itself, with its elegant architecture, enhances the viewing experience.
